For precise thermal control in satellites under varying internal heat dissipation and thermal boundary condition, we have proposed a MEMS radiator enhanced by near-field effect. Here, we analyse the near-field effect in multi-layered structure in order to estimate the effect of the dielectric layer on the device performance. It is shown that the ON/OFF heat flux ratio of 4.1 can be achieved with a 50 nm-thick SiO2 layer sandwiched between the electrodes. Also, it is experimentally shown that, with our prototype radiator, 2.4 times enhancement in the radiation heat flux has been obtained.
